Drumming, Dance and Storytelling Heat Up Solon Library

Karamu House performers encourage participation at Solon Library event

Call:"Ago!"

Response: "Ame!"

Those were the first words learned in the community room in Solon Public Library as the Karamu House performers took the floor.Β  Talise, Timothy and Yvetta captured the audience by introducing them to songs, stories and dance from West Africa. Infants danced in their parents' arms, kids yelled on cue and everyone smiled. With dance, call and response the evening ended with the message: "Peace, love and respect for everybody."
